determine the area of a 21ft circle
Respuesta :
sqdancefan
sqdancefan
04-03-2018
A = (π/4)*d^2
.. = (π/4)*(21 ft)^2
.. = 110.25π ft^2
.. ≈ 346.36 ft^2
